Regulatory and Criminal Proceedings

Our regulatory specialists possess recognised expertise in the following areas:

  • Advising parties concerned with or effected by FSA investigations
  • Representing individuals who are subject to enforcement proceedings
  • Assisting persons with contentious authorisation processes

Increasingly the FSA is making use of both its regulatory and criminal powers to bring proceedings against persons working in the financial services sector, which previously would have been dealt with by the principal criminal law enforcement agencies.  This is particularly so in relation to market abuse. Russell Jones & Walker is distinct from many firms practising in this area in that we are widely regarded as a leading firm in the representation of those under investigation and/or prosecution for complex crime. This enables us to analyse problems from both a criminal and a regulatory perspective and advise our clients accordingly.

Employment

The FSA Unit covers all areas of employment law including specific issues arising within the Financial Services Industry, such as the granting/withdrawal of approved persons status, the test for fitness and propriety, individual compliance and disclosure obligations, restrictive covenants, data protection and whistleblowing.

Civil Litigation

Our litigation experts are able to deal with major cases where individuals face serious sanctions and consequences under the civil law.  Examples include civil/commercial fraud, breach of fiduciary duty, directors disqualification proceedings and injunctive proceedings.
